When a child dies, we expect grief. What we don’t often recognize… is how grief itself becomes judged. In this episode of Beyond the Loss: Life and Identity After a Child Dies, I explore what I call the moralization of grief—the subtle, often unspoken ways we assign meaning, legitimacy, and even hierarchy to different types of loss.
